Chromium Code Reviews
chromiumcodereview-hr@appspot.gserviceaccount.com (chromiumcodereview-hr) | Please choose your nickname with Settings | Help | Chromium Project | Gerrit Changes | Sign out
(320)

Side by Side Diff: mojo/dart/packages/_mojo_for_test_only/lib/mojo/test/test_included_unions.mojom.dart

Issue 2006093002: Dart: Futures -> Callbacks. (Closed) Base URL: git@github.com:domokit/mojo.git@master
Patch Set: Merge Created 4 years, 6 months ago
Use n/p to move between diff chunks; N/P to move between comments. Draft comments are only viewable by you.
Jump to:
View unified diff | Download patch
OLDNEW
1 // WARNING: DO NOT EDIT. This file was generated by a program. 1 // WARNING: DO NOT EDIT. This file was generated by a program.
2 // See $MOJO_SDK/tools/bindings/mojom_bindings_generator.py. 2 // See $MOJO_SDK/tools/bindings/mojom_bindings_generator.py.
3 3
4 library test_included_unions_mojom; 4 library test_included_unions_mojom;
5 import 'dart:collection'; 5 import 'dart:collection';
6 import 'dart:convert'; 6 import 'dart:convert';
7 import 'dart:io'; 7 import 'dart:io';
8 import 'dart:typed_data'; 8 import 'dart:typed_data';
9 import 'package:mojo/bindings.dart' as bindings; 9 import 'package:mojo/bindings.dart' as bindings;
10 import 'package:mojo/mojo/bindings/types/mojom_types.mojom.dart' as mojom_types; 10 import 'package:mojo/mojo/bindings/types/mojom_types.mojom.dart' as mojom_types;
(...skipping 85 matching lines...) Expand 10 before | Expand all | Expand 10 after
96 96
97 Map<String, mojom_types.UserDefinedType> getAllMojomTypeDefinitions() { 97 Map<String, mojom_types.UserDefinedType> getAllMojomTypeDefinitions() {
98 return getRuntimeTypeInfo().typeMap; 98 return getRuntimeTypeInfo().typeMap;
99 } 99 }
100 100
101 var _runtimeTypeInfo; 101 var _runtimeTypeInfo;
102 mojom_types.RuntimeTypeInfo _initRuntimeTypeInfo() { 102 mojom_types.RuntimeTypeInfo _initRuntimeTypeInfo() {
103 // serializedRuntimeTypeInfo contains the bytes of the Mojo serialization of 103 // serializedRuntimeTypeInfo contains the bytes of the Mojo serialization of
104 // a mojom_types.RuntimeTypeInfo struct describing the Mojom types in this 104 // a mojom_types.RuntimeTypeInfo struct describing the Mojom types in this
105 // file. The string contains the base64 encoding of the gzip-compressed bytes. 105 // file. The string contains the base64 encoding of the gzip-compressed bytes.
106 var serializedRuntimeTypeInfo = "H4sIAAAJbogC/5JggAABKG0ApdHFYTQHGo2uzgGJz4ikT gOIFYA4JDLANd7bNdIqNz8rX68ktbhEzzMvOac0JTUlNC8zP08Cqg+knwmPPWBFSPYxoLkfJv4fCgIYs ANRIOYFYhRHAPnyQCwOxDicieEediBmA+JEII4EYv2M/NxU/aLSlPzczLzUIn2QOfrFRckQRkFpUk5ms n5mXklqUVpicmqxflJmXkpmXnqxPsguCBmfCbUxvhRkZbEeSGsunvBlgIYxsruY0fyLK7wYkMIL2Tx0w Am1NxFHvHBAw4Je4QAIAAD//8B6whbAAgAA"; 106 var serializedRuntimeTypeInfo = "H4sIAAAJbogC/7yRsU/FIBDGeZroczBxMb5NR6eecXRye YNx6aBDp4ZSrBgKBsriP6+HvSYUxdFLfr1COL6vX3dsrjPqN9Tz/aVvs56fu0/Wm+TcNXKFPDX1vn3cN 3ejfbPVJP1UPRihQy/7Z6Os2dFcnD/4Q2e7WeuxzP+y/0lVs9/rHDlFViZwfYlcIAWbP/wcI0fxPCIRC N6BtoJrGKwdtIRXO0r4cBzilbfgnfh+g/fQaSVAmUm6Fy6kh06ZXpnBQ9Sdn60i9TZEeV/F0bGQM6OsU 3+H2XeXcmNJbul9eZ2QLi/9H8rkv/P4CgAA///OToRD0AIAAA==";
107 107
108 // Deserialize RuntimeTypeInfo 108 // Deserialize RuntimeTypeInfo
109 var bytes = BASE64.decode(serializedRuntimeTypeInfo); 109 var bytes = BASE64.decode(serializedRuntimeTypeInfo);
110 var unzippedBytes = new ZLibDecoder().convert(bytes); 110 var unzippedBytes = new ZLibDecoder().convert(bytes);
111 var bdata = new ByteData.view(unzippedBytes.buffer); 111 var bdata = new ByteData.view(unzippedBytes.buffer);
112 var message = new bindings.Message(bdata, null, unzippedBytes.length, 0); 112 var message = new bindings.Message(bdata, null, unzippedBytes.length, 0);
113 _runtimeTypeInfo = mojom_types.RuntimeTypeInfo.deserialize(message); 113 _runtimeTypeInfo = mojom_types.RuntimeTypeInfo.deserialize(message);
114 return _runtimeTypeInfo; 114 return _runtimeTypeInfo;
115 } 115 }
OLDNEW

Powered by Google App Engine
This is Rietveld 408576698